Here are the latest version of the backpack gerbers 2018-09-16_042411_stm32h7V1.3.zip This version allows a 5" SSD1963 display to be mounted with supports. It also includes a Pi compatible header supporting any of the Pi "HATS", an IR receiver, and optional pullups on 8 of the I/O pins for things like DS18B20 as well as the V1.2 connections (ESP8266, OV7670 camera, SSD1963, ILI9341, 4*Com, 3*SPI, I2C, SDcard, Battery for RTC, Audio jack). In addition it includes a console port and an optional 8MHz oscillator allowing the Nucleo to be used with the STlink removed if required. The version pictured has a silkscreen error (touch connections for the Pi header should be 112,56 ), also the spacing of the 3.3V pins under COM4 should be 0.1" under the ground pins but are actually 0.125" but the gerbers are correct. |
